Attorney Sally A. Stix has over 30 years experience practicing employment and labor law. She opened her own practice in Chicago after graduating from Chicago Kent College of Law in 1979. In 1993, she relocated to Madison, Wisconsin. Ms. Stix is licensed and practices in both Wisconsin and Illinois. She represents employees before state and federal agencies, in state and federal district courts, before the Illinois and Wisconsin appellate courts, the Seventh Circuit Court of Appeals and the United States Supreme Court. She is a member of the National Employment Lawyers Association and its Wisconsin affiliate, the National Lawyers Guild, the Legal Association of Women and the labor and employment and individual rights and responsibilities sections of the State Bar of Wisconsin. She currently sits on the board of directors of the individual rights and responsibilities section. Ms. Stix has represented numerous unions, including locals of the United Food & Commercial Workers, United Electrical Workers and registered and licensed practical nurses. Since returning to Wisconsin, she has represented the industrial workers at ARAMARK laundry and the State of Wisconsin law enforcement bargaining unit, which includes Wisconsin ’s state troopers, UW and Capitol Police and Transportation Customer Representatives. Other clients include a Madison community radio station, WORT FM, a women ’s theater company and numerous individual employees. Ms. Stix has given presentations on federal employees ’ rights at National Employment Lawyers ’ Association Conventions and seminars and lectured at high schools on sexual harassment. In 1974, Ms. Stix graduated from the University of Wisconsin Madison with a bachelor ’s degree in philosophy. She was born and raised in Cincinnati, Ohio and became involved in the Civil Rights movement while still in high school. Since that time, she has been and remains an activist for progressive change. She is a current member of the board of her neighborhood association and volunteers for a youth peer court.
